Dobermans got their start in the late 19th century, when a German tax collector named Louis Dobermann wanted a medium-sized pet to act as both a guard dog and companion. The valedictorians of the dog world, these herders took the top spot in Stanley Coren's intelligence rankings, meaning most can learn a new command in under five repetitions and follow it at least 95% of the time. Highly intelligent, work-oriented, and lively, the Australian Shepherd is a breed developed from the Basque Shepherd, Collie, and Border Collie, among others, and was, in fact, developed in the American West, not Australia. ", Looking at a study from earlier this year, Coren shared, "Data were obtained from 1,888 dogs, and the results were unambiguous. The book was published in 1994 and updated in 2006, and remains the landmark piece of literature on the subject.
